Crucial breakthrough in fake drug case; Person who trapped beauty parlour owner Sheela Sunny identified, directed to appear for questioning

KOCHI: Mastermind behind the fake drug case targeting Sheela Sunny, owner of She Style Beauty Parlor in Chalakudy has been identified. Narayana Das, a resident of Tripunithura Erur and a friend of Sheela's cousin is accused of providing false information to the Excise Department.

Das, now under investigation, allegedly misled Excise Inspector K Satheesan by falsely implicating Sheela in a synthetic lethal drug case. Sheela spent 72 days behind bars after a stamp of the said drug was found in her bag during an inspection at her beauty parlour led by Excise Inspector Satheesan.

The investigation revealed that Narayana Das, introducing himself as Satish had informed the Iringalakuda Excise CI about the alleged drug possession through a WhatsApp call. Das claimed that a stamp would be found in Sheela's bag or cart and suggested a specific time for the inspection.

Impersonation and providing false information to law enforcement are serious offenses, akin to drug possession. The investigating team has summoned Narayana Das for questioning regarding his role in the orchestrated incident.

Sheela, who initially suspected the involvement of a close relative was eventually found innocent in the subsequent investigation.
